aboutsummaryrefslogtreecommitdiff
path: root/app/dispatch/management/commands/insert_fake_data.py
diff options
context:
space:
mode:
authorMitch Riedstra <mitch@riedstra.us>2017-10-24 19:09:24 -0400
committerMitch Riedstra <mitch@riedstra.us>2017-10-24 19:09:24 -0400
commit61dc16200b5ada1c16def723498e61d1bb112da3 (patch)
tree160470f903525e5509e6962149017e6307e38789 /app/dispatch/management/commands/insert_fake_data.py
parent618676efca076cd8a72f12e5c4db2413c4605eff (diff)
downloaddispatch-tracker-61dc16200b5ada1c16def723498e61d1bb112da3.tar.gz
dispatch-tracker-61dc16200b5ada1c16def723498e61d1bb112da3.tar.xz
Remove all old migrations and start fresh. Re-arranged models to better fit Invoice model
Diffstat (limited to 'app/dispatch/management/commands/insert_fake_data.py')
-rw-r--r--app/dispatch/management/commands/insert_fake_data.py11
1 files changed, 10 insertions, 1 deletions
diff --git a/app/dispatch/management/commands/insert_fake_data.py b/app/dispatch/management/commands/insert_fake_data.py
index 5d4203d..2969900 100644
--- a/app/dispatch/management/commands/insert_fake_data.py
+++ b/app/dispatch/management/commands/insert_fake_data.py
@@ -1,6 +1,6 @@
from django.core.management.base import BaseCommand, CommandError
from django.contrib.auth import get_user_model
-from dispatch.models import Customer, Load
+from dispatch.models import Customer, Load, Identity
from faker import Faker
import random
@@ -106,6 +106,15 @@ class Command(BaseCommand):
is_active=True
)
new_user.save()
+ user_ident = Identity(
+ user=new_user,
+ name="{} {}".format(ffname, flname),
+ address=self.fake.address(),
+ city=self.fake.city(),
+ state=self.fake.state(),
+ zip_code=self.fake.zipcode(),
+ )
+ user_ident.save()
return new_user
except IntegrityError:
# Around and around we go until we get something new